Description: Avalonia UI is an open source cross-platform UI framework for .NET apps. It allows developers to create desktop GUI apps that run on Windows, Linux and macOS using .NET technologies like XAML.

Description: Fox toolkit is an open-source set of UI components for developing desktop applications. It provides widgets like buttons, menus, toolbars, grids, and more out of the box to build Windows, Linux, and macOS apps in C++ quickly.

Avalonia UI
Avalonia UI
Pros
  • Open source with MIT license
  • Lightweight and fast
  • Native look and feel
  • Good documentation
  • Active development community
Cons
  • Less mature than WPF
  • Limited control availability compared to WPF
  • Smaller user base currently
Fox toolkit
Fox toolkit
Pros
  • Saves development time by providing ready-made UI components
  • Native look and feel on each platform
  • Good documentation and community support
Cons
  • Limited to desktop app development (no web or mobile)
  • Steeper learning curve than web frameworks
  • Smaller community than platforms like Electron
